Cracked stucco repair services involve fixing damage to the exterior finish of a building’s walls, typically when cracks or holes appear in the stucco coating. Over time, weather exposure, settling foundations, or structural shifts can cause these cracks to develop, leading to potential moisture intrusion and further deterioration if left unaddressed.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to carefully remove damaged sections, fill cracks, and restore the surface to a smooth, uniform appearance. Proper repair not only improves the aesthetic of a property but also helps protect it from moisture damage and structural issues.

Cracked stucco is often a sign of underlying problems that need attention. Small surface cracks might be purely cosmetic, but larger or expanding cracks can indicate movement in the building’s foundation or issues with the framing. Water infiltration through cracks can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and other costly repairs. Service providers can assess the severity of the damage and recommend appropriate solutions, which may include patching, sealing, or more extensive repair work. Addressing these issues promptly helps prevent further damage and extends the lifespan of the property’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ical Cracked Stucco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Crofton,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or cracks and surface issues,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and surface area involved.

Moderate Repairs - Larger patches or more extensive surface prep gener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homes needing significant touch-ups or localized repairs.

Partial Replacements - When sections of stucco need removal and replacement, costs can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Projects in this tier are less frequent but are often necessary for damaged or deteriorating areas.

Full Wall or Building Replacement - Complete stucco removal and reapplication can reach $5,000 or more for larger structures. Such projects are less common and typically involve extensive surface work or structural concerns.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es stucco to crack? Cracks in stucco can result from factors such as settling of the building, moisture infiltration, or temperature fluctuations affecting the material's expansion and contraction.

How can I tell if my stucco needs repairs? Signs include visible cracks, bubbling or peeling paint, and areas where the stucco appears loose or damaged, indicating that repair may be necessary.

Are there different types of stucco repairs available? Yes, repair options can include patching small cracks, re-skimming damaged areas, or replacing sections of stucco to restore the surface.

What are common methods used by contractors to fix cracked stucco? Contractors often use techniques such as filling cracks with specialized sealants, applying new layers of stucco, or using mesh reinforcement for larger repairs.
